## Formula sandbox tuning

User-supplied formulas in Gridmoor execute inside a restricted interpreter with hard ceilings on time, memory, and call depth. Reviewers should confirm any change to these ceilings is justified in the PR description, since raising them widens the abuse surface. Defaults were chosen from production traces. The current limits are as follows.

limits module of tafog-fawip:
WEIGHTS = {
    "julix": 57,
    "lamys": 992,
    "kasvan": 209,
    "quenok": 750,
    "alddor": 259,
    "oliath": 1009,
    "wenix": 815,
}

## Break-Glass Access — StockRoute Planner

Scope: emergency-only access to the StockRoute restock planner's production scheduler. Normal reviews never require it. Break glass only when a planning run deadlocks and machines across the Calverton depot miss restock windows. Procedure: file an incident, notify the Tinfield duty lead, then unlock the override console. Every session is recorded and reviewed within 24 hours. Misuse revokes reviewer privileges. The override console requires the recovery passphrase, which is printed directly below.

unlock words, yawig-kagef: gordor-holvan-ulaael-pramir-ulaiel-tamdor

# Break-Glass: Sheetforge Export Memory

Large exports from Sheetforge can exhaust worker memory and stall the Dunlow cluster. Break-glass lets a reviewer kill the export daemon and flush its arena directly. Use only when the standard restart fails. Each use is logged and audited weekly by the Fernholt team. To open the emergency shell, supply the passphrase below.

recovery phrase for bawef-haduf: wenax-druox-julmir